dc.description.abstract | The main aim of this study was to determine what energy savings could be obtained when making use of a variable speed drive. The MIA facilities department chose one of the three main plant rooms, being the East plant room, to introduce a variable speed drive to each motor. Once a better picture is obtained of what savings can be obtained, how much carbon emissions are reduced and the payback of the variable speed drive, a decision will be taken on whether to also replace the other plant rooms. This study provides an explanation on the different methods for driving an induction motor and the advantages and disadvantages of each method. This study concentrates on the air handling unit fans and did not take other motors, such as pump motors into consideration. The main aim these motors were studied, is due to the fact that the air handling unit fans, do not need to operate at full speed constantly and this therefore means that the variable speed drives can be utilized to reduce the speed of the motor and therefore reduce power. In this study, before and after readings of the supply power are taken from one AHU in the East plant room. Simulations are also done, to compare the results obtained, with those in practice. Once the results are obtained, the percentage savings obtained by the introduction of the variable speed drives is calculated. | en_GB |
